How do you know which is the best casting reel for you?
We're going to start from the premise that we're looking for a versatile casting reel capable of handling a good proportion of the lures on the market. So we're going to focus on a power range between 10 and 60 grams.
The first factor is weight! It's important to have a good weight/performance ratio so that you're not exhausted at the end of the day, especially if you're fishing one day after another.
The second factor is performance! Having a reel is all very well, but if its performance is limited, you'll soon be disappointed.
The final factor is durability. To be the best casting reel, it's very important that it stands the test of time!
The best casting mill by weight: ZPI Alcance

For the Rodmaps team, one casting reel stands out for its weight. This is the ZPI Alcance!
ZPI is the world's number 1 manufacturer of customised parts for fishing reels. They therefore have unique expertise in optimising the characteristics of a casting reel. They have succeeded in making an 'SRV' reel weighing just 11.4g.
This reel weighs just 178g, although some parts are made of aluminium. The frame, on the other hand, is made of carbon composite.
Model | Ratio | recovery | Crank length |
ZPI Alcance NS (Normal Speed) | 6.6 | 70cm | 86mm |
ZPI Alcance HS (High Speed) | 7.3 | 77cm | 86mm |
ZPI Alcance XS (Extra Speed) | 8.1 | 86cm | 90mm |

In this category, Shimano's DC (Digital Control) system is still unrivalled by its competitors. That said, you have to be careful, because the DC system varies depending on the Shimano reel range. For example, the DC system on a Curado DC is not as powerful as that on a Metanium DC.

The best casting reel for its solidity: Calcutta Conquest 201
Solid and robust, we are of course talking about Shimano's round profile, the Calcutta Conquest 201! It's a master in its class. This little gem also boasts an extremely light MGL spool and a micromodule system to increase smoothness during retrieve. It has a lot of the same qualities as the Antares DC, but the round profiles are not as easy to handle as the low-profiles. (see article on how to choose your casting reel))
